Technical Specifications Suzuki V-Strom 650 2011 compared to Yamaha Tracer 7 2022

Suzuki V-Strom 650 2011
Yamaha Tracer 7 2022

Engine and Drive Train

BoreBore81 mmBore80 mm
StrokeStroke62.6 mmStroke68.6 mm
Engine powerEngine power67 HPEngine power73.4 HP
Rpm at Max. PowerRpm at Max. Power8,800 rpmRpm at Max. Power8,750 rpm
TorqueTorque60 NmTorque68 Nm
Rpm at TorqueRpm at Torque6,400 rpmRpm at Torque6,500 rpm
Compression RatioCompression Ratio11.5 Compression Ratio11.5
TransmissionTransmissionChainTransmissionChain
Number of gearsNumber of gears6Number of gears6
StrokesStrokes4-StrokeStrokes4-Stroke
ValvesValvesDOHCValvesDOHC
DisplacementDisplacement645 ccmDisplacement689 ccm

Suspension Front

AdjustmentAdjustmentPreloadAdjustmentPreload, Rebound

Suspension Rear

AdjustmentAdjustmentPreloadAdjustmentPreload, Rebound

Chassis

FrameFrameAluminiumFrameSteel

Brakes Front

TypeTypeDouble diskTypeDouble disk
PistonPistonDouble pistonPistonFour pistons

Brakes Rear

TypeTypeDiscTypeDisc
PistonPistonSingle pistonPistonFour pistons

Dimensions and Weights

Front tyre widthFront tyre width110 mmFront tyre width120 mm
Front tyre heightFront tyre height80 %Front tyre height70 %
Front tyre diameterFront tyre diameter19 inchFront tyre diameter17 inch
Rear tyre widthRear tyre width150 mmRear tyre width180 mm
Rear tyre heightRear tyre height70 %Rear tyre height55 %
Rear tyre diameterRear tyre diameter17 inchRear tyre diameter17 inch
LengthLength2,290 mmLength2,130 mm
WidthWidth840 mmWidth806 mm
HeightHeight1,390 mmHeight1,290 mm
WheelbaseWheelbase1,555 mmWheelbase1,460 mm
Seat HeightSeat Height820 mmSeat Height840 mm
Kerb Weight (with ABS)Kerb Weight (with ABS)220 kgKerb Weight (with ABS)196 kg
Fuel Tank CapacityFuel Tank Capacity22 lFuel Tank Capacity17 l
License compliancyLicense compliancyALicense compliancyA2, A

Yamaha Tracer 7 2022

Yamaha Tracer 7 2022

If you are looking for a motorbike under 10,000 euros with an excellent engine, cool looks and comfort, the Yamaha Tracer 7 is the right choice. The low weight and adjustable chassis make the Tracer 700 a real cornering machine. Purists will be pleased to know that, apart from ABS, there are no electronic aids, but when you look at the competition, this no longer seems quite state-of-the-art.

powerful engine

agile handling

adjustable chassis

comfortable ergonomics

cool look

large selection of accessories

Load change at low revs

weak brake

hardly any electronics

little wind protection compared to the competition.
